The Card Verification Code, or CVC*, is an extra code printed on your debit or credit card. With American Express the CVC appears as a separate 4-digit code printed on the front of your card. With all other cards (Visa, MasterCard, bank cards etc.) it is the final three digits of the number printed on the signature strip on the reverse of your card. As the CVC is not embossed (like the card number), the CVC is not printed on any receipts, hence it is not likely to be known by anyone other than the actual card owner.

We ask you to fill out the CVC here to verify beyond any doubt that you actually hold the card you are using for this transaction, and to avoid anyone other than you from shopping with your card number. All information you submit is transferred over secure SSL connections.

* The name of this code differs per card company. You may also know it as the Card Verification Value (CVV), the Card Security Code or the Personal Security Code. All names cover the same type of information.
